Enhancing Patient Comfort with Innovative Bedside Table Designs



The Importance of a Patient Bedside Table in Healthcare


In the healthcare setting, every element of a patient’s environment can play a crucial role in their overall experience and recovery. Among various furnishings, the patient bedside table stands out as a seemingly simple yet profoundly significant piece of furniture. This article delves into the importance of the patient bedside table, exploring its functionalities, benefits, and impact on patient care.


Essential Functions of the Patient Bedside Table


The primary function of a patient bedside table is to provide a convenient surface for personal items and essential medical equipment. Typically positioned adjacent to the patient’s bed, it serves several critical purposes


1. Storage for Personal Items During a hospital stay, patients often have personal items such as glasses, mobile phones, books, or photographs. The bedside table provides a safe and easily accessible space to store these personal belongings, allowing patients to feel more at home in an unfamiliar environment.


2. Placement for Medical Equipment Bedside tables are designed to hold vital medical equipment such as call buttons, medication trays, and even IV controls. This accessibility ensures patients can reach their needs without unnecessary movement, thereby promoting comfort and safety.


3. Workspace for Care Providers Healthcare professionals use the bedside table as a practical workspace for administering care. It can hold supplies for wound dressing, medication preparation, or charts and information for monitoring the patient’s health. This dual functionality enhances the efficiency of care delivery.


Enhancing Patient Experience


The design and arrangement of the bedside table contribute significantly to the patient experience. A well-organized and clutter-free bedside environment can lead to improved mental well-being. Here’s how

1. Promoting Autonomy Having a bedside table encourages patients to take charge of their own belongings and manage their personal space. This sense of control can be empowering, which is vital in a setting where many aspects of their lives feel dictated by healthcare processes.


2. Facilitating Communication The bedside table can serve as a focal point for family members and visitors. When loved ones come to visit, they often gather around the bedside table, creating a space for conversation and interaction. This engagement is critical in maintaining emotional support for patients, which can aid in their recovery.


3. Encouraging Interaction with Care Staff Healthcare providers can use the bedside table as a setting for discussions about treatment plans, medications, and patient care. A dedicated space fosters an open line of communication, helping patients feel more involved in their healthcare decisions.


Safety and Accessibility


Modern designs of patient bedside tables often prioritize safety and accessibility. Features may include rounded edges to prevent injury, adjustable heights for ease of use, and non-slip surfaces to secure items in place. Such considerations are vital in catering to the diverse needs of patients with varying levels of mobility and health conditions.


The Psychological Impact


The psychological aspect of having a personalized bedside table cannot be overlooked. The presence of personal items and the ability to arrange them can alleviate the feelings of anxiety and helplessness that often accompany hospital stays. Research indicates that when patients have opportunities for personalization in their environment, they tend to experience reduced levels of stress and improved satisfaction with their care.
